My BTO is taking longer than the usual. The other BTO which was launch in the same month had already gotten their keys to their new nest and here I am, still waiting...


Applied for the BTO in early 2010 and as of Jul 2013, there's still no news from HDB yet.
I take it as HDB is giving us more time to save up for the reno.

We are currently at the ID/Contractor hunting stage, have met up with a few ID but still unable to decide on one yet. Shall continue to explore...
  1. I**** House
    Came to know about ID (S***) through friend's recommendation, reviews of I**** House was also quite positive in renotalk. He was the first ID we met up with, had the temptation to just sign up with him but the quotation was out of our budget and he also took quite long to send us the quotation and revised quotation (despite pointing out the error during the meeting, the revised quote is still not amended).
  2. D' P*** Studio Pte Ltd

    Hubby went ID hunting and walk in to this place. J**** who attended to him was very detailed. Hubby went site visiting and likes his work and sent me a few photos. His quote was slightly above our budget but I don't really like his work.

  3. Dec****** Design
    This is also walk in. It was a lady who attended Hubby. I would say she is very attentive and detailed, she did imagine herself staying in the layout she/we proposed and tells us pros and cons which others did not. Quotation slight above our budget and we proceed with the site visiting of her colleague. Carpentry work looks good but tiling is below my expectation.

  4. Mr K
    After reading all the good reviews of Mr K, we decided to request for a quotation from him. Understand that his quote might be on the higher end but quality seems to be assured. We are still pending for a quotation from him. Hopefully it's within our budget.

***Update***

PCD on HDB website has been updated to September 2013! We will be getting our keys in a few months time!

We agreed to confirm an ID/contractor asap, to have more time (est 3 months) to choose our tiles and etc.

Met up with Mr K last Saturday (20/07) for site visiting. We visited 2 houses in Punggol, very nicely done up but also noticed that most of the houses done by him have repetitive design, one example is the colour combination (most probably they have the same style/theme).

Received a revised quotation yesterday (22/07), very fast! The Mr has given the green light to proceed, in the mist of arranging for the 3rd meet up to confirm and we will be able to start choosing our tiles and laminates.
